Researcher urges digital health transformation to expand preventive care access in marginalized communities

Healthcare disparities between affluent and marginalized communities have persisted despite decades of policy interventions and technological advancement. Now, as digital health tools proliferate, a critical question emerges: will these technologies help bridge the healthcare access gap or deepen existing inequities? Opeoluwa Oluwanifemi Akomolafe argues forcefully that the answer depends entirely on how intentionally health systems design digital interventions with equity as the central organizing principle.

In a comprehensive framework published in the International Journal of Advanced Multidisciplinary Research and Studies, Akomolafe presents a vision for leveraging digital health technologies—telemedicine platforms, mobile health applications, electronic health records, and artificial intelligence-driven tools—to expand access to preventive services for populations that have historically been excluded from such care. Her perspective is shaped by a career trajectory that spans healthcare delivery in Nigeria and the United Kingdom, including her current role as a Community and Complex Support Worker at Caremark Rotherham and Sheffield, where she provides specialized care to individuals with complex health needs in their homes.

What distinguishes Akomolafe’s framework is her refusal to treat technology as a solution unto itself. Instead, she positions digital tools as enablers within a broader ecosystem that must include community engagement, cultural responsiveness, digital literacy programming, and robust privacy protections. “Marginalized communities often face systemic barriers that limit their access to essential preventive health services,” she notes in the publication, identifying not just technological gaps but intertwined challenges of economic instability, geographic isolation, language differences, and historical mistrust in healthcare systems.

The framework Akomolafe proposes integrates four core components: telemedicine and virtual consultations to overcome geographic barriers; mobile health applications tailored to provide preventive information, appointment reminders, and behavior change support; electronic health records to ensure continuity of care across fragmented service delivery systems; and artificial intelligence-driven risk stratification to identify and prioritize high-risk individuals for early intervention. Critically, she emphasizes that each component must be accompanied by support structures—digital literacy training, community-based digital access points, and systematic evaluation mechanisms—to ensure effective adoption and sustained engagement.

Her research draws on evidence from pilot implementations that demonstrated measurable impacts: a twenty-seven percent increase in immunization coverage for children under five, a thirty-five percent increase in antenatal care visits among pregnant women, and doubled screening rates for hypertension and diabetes among at-risk adults. Perhaps more significantly, the pilots documented a forty-two percent reduction in transportation costs for patients in rural areas, addressing one of the most persistent barriers to healthcare access. These outcomes emerged not from technology deployment alone but from comprehensive programs that combined digital tools with community health worker support, culturally adapted content, and sustained engagement with community leaders.

Yet Akomolafe is clear-eyed about the substantial challenges that threaten to undermine digital health equity initiatives. Her research documents significant digital literacy gaps, particularly among older adults and individuals with limited formal education—populations that often have the greatest health needs. Infrastructure limitations, including intermittent connectivity and unreliable power supply in remote areas, posed ongoing operational challenges during pilot implementations. Most concerning, she identifies privacy concerns and user trust as persistent barriers, particularly among women and marginalized groups with historical experiences of discrimination within healthcare systems.

From her vantage point working with individuals with neurological conditions, learning disabilities, and multiple long-term conditions in Sheffield and Rotherham, Akomolafe understands that expanding access to preventive care requires more than efficient service delivery—it demands recognition of the dignity, autonomy, and lived expertise of the communities being served. Her framework explicitly calls for co-design approaches that involve community members not just as recipients of services but as partners in defining what preventive care should look like and how it should be delivered.

As healthcare systems face mounting pressure to address health inequities while managing resource constraints, Akomolafe’s work offers a sobering reminder: digital health technologies hold genuine promise for expanding preventive care access, but realizing that promise requires intentional, sustained investment in the social and structural conditions that enable marginalized communities to benefit from technological innovation. Without such investment, she warns, digital health risks becoming yet another mechanism through which healthcare disparities are reproduced and reinforced.
